WILSON (VILLARI, FRIANT), DIANE L., - 73, a permanent resident of Cape May County, passed away on Saturday, January 25. Diane was born and raised in Hammonton, NJ and attended St. Joseph's School, where she participated in Debate Club, Glee Club, Junior and Senior Choir, Drum & Bugle Corps, softball and basketball. She later received an Associate Degree in Applied Science from Cumberland County College (Phi Theta Kappa), a Bachelor of Science from Richard Stockton State College, a Master of Aeronautical Science from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University, and a Master's Certificate in Project Management from George Washington University. Diane was a certified Project Management Professional and a certified Acquisition Professional for the Department of Homeland Security, Transportation Security Administration. She worked as a contractor and government computer specialist and system engineer for the Federal Aviation Administration at the William J. Hughes Technical Center (WJHTC) in Pomona and as a Computer Scientist and System Engineer in Modeling & Simulation and other areas for DHS/TSA at the Aviation Security Lab, WJHTC, retiring in July, 2008. Diane and her husband, Walt were avid Square Dancers for over 20 years, enjoyed camping and RVing and traveled in all 50 states and Australia together.
